Marjorie Taylor Greene Warns Trump Over Epstein: ‘The Base Will Turn And There’s No Going Back’
UNITED STATES, JUL 21 – Marjorie Taylor Greene says MAGA supporters demand full release of Epstein files and warns partial disclosures won’t prevent them from turning against Trump, amid growing base frustration.
- Representative Marjorie Taylor Greene cautioned President Donald Trump that if he does not take firm action against emerging threats, the loyalty of his MAGA followers may waver.
- This warning followed growing pressure on Trump to release Jeffrey Epstein-related grand jury testimony amid frustration over his handling of the files and dismissive remarks.
- Greene urged Trump to take decisive action against alleged deep state treason, election meddling, blackmail, and powerful elite conspiracies, emphasizing that supporters are no longer content with small gestures and instead demand comprehensive accountability.
- Last week, Trump directed the Justice Department to make public the grand jury materials related to Epstein, leading to social media calls for arrests that aligned with Greene’s viewpoint.
- Greene’s warning and the base’s frustration indicate a possible turning point in MAGA support, increasing pressure on Trump to respond firmly to internal and external threats.

Right-leaning outlets divide as Fox and Newsmax clash over Epstein: Bias Breakdown
The Epstein case is back in the news following the release of a DOJ memo stating there was no client list. While coverage of the development has surged on some networks, others — particularly on the political right — have devoted less time to the story.
